Description

Ross & Joass, circa 1860-4, Ruskinian Gothic detail,

snecked rubble with ashlar dressings. Large 2 storeys and

attic, asymmetrical front with advanced left hand bay and

lower service wing at right. Porch and arched doorpiece.

Bargeboards to all gables. West elevation with 2-storey

canted window at south. Tall shaped and corniced stacks.

Octagonal gatepiers. Garden wall, rubble.
